"bond conversion" is a correct and usable phrase in written English.
This term refers to the process of converting a bond into another form, such as exchanging it for stock or changing its maturity date. It is commonly used in the finance and investment industry. Examples: 1. The bond conversion option allowed investors to exchange their bonds for shares of the company's stock. 2. The company's debt restructuring plan included a bond conversion strategy to reduce its interest payments. 3. Before making any decisions, the financial advisor carefully evaluated the potential benefits and risks of the bond conversion. 4. The bond conversion process was completed successfully, resulting in a more favorable interest rate for the company. 5. The bond conversion rate was set at a premium, incentivizing investors to convert their bonds into equity.
